Rosh Hashanah During War: Faith, Family, and Thousands in Uman, in Photos
Thousands of Jewish pilgrims journeyed to Uman to pray at the grave of a revered Rabbi Nachman of Bratslav. Their Rosh Hashanah prayers for renewal and peace are intertwined with the ongoing devastation of the war in Ukraine. In the narrow streets and crowded courtyards, the rituals of pilgrimage became both an act of faith and a moment of reflection.
Every year, Jewish people travel long distances to the city of Uman in Ukraine. They go there to visit the grave of Rabbi Nachman, a Jewish spiritual leader who lived over 200 years ago. He promised that anyone who came to him on Rosh Hashanah, the Jewish New Year, would have their prayers answered. That’s why thousands still gather there today to pray.
